I just don't get how Carolina gets TWO forward reps, and Jagr on pace for 100+ points is left off.
Anyways, I think the best idea for the fans would be to ice the defending cup champs against the best the rest of the league can muster. That would be an entertaining game. In fact that was the format from 1947-1968. I'm sure the GMs and owners would not go for it though.
